PPF Interest Rate History
Rates set by Government of India, revised quarterly
| Period | Rate | Change |
|---|---|---|
| Oct 2024 – Present | 7.10% | – |
| Apr 2023 – Sep 2024 | 7.10% | – |
| Jan 2023 – Mar 2023 | 7.10% | – |
| Oct 2022 – Dec 2022 | 7.10% | ▲ +0.10% |
| Apr 2020 – Sep 2022 | 7.10% | ▼ -0.90% |
| Apr 2019 – Mar 2020 | 7.90% | ▼ -0.10% |
| Oct 2018 – Mar 2019 | 8.00% | ▲ +0.20% |
| Jan 2018 – Sep 2018 | 7.60% | ▼ -0.20% |
| Apr 2017 – Dec 2017 | 7.80% | ▼ -0.30% |
| Apr 2016 – Mar 2017 | 8.10% | ▼ -0.60% |
| Apr 2013 – Mar 2016 | 8.70% | – |

Why PPF is India's Safest Investment
Government-backed, tax-free, and compounding — PPF is the gold standard for risk-free wealth building.
Government Guaranteed
PPF is backed by the sovereign guarantee of the Government of India. Your principal and interest are 100% safe, unlike bank FDs which are insured only up to ₹5 lakh.
Triple Tax Exemption
PPF has EEE (Exempt-Exempt-Exempt) status: Deposit qualifies for Section 80C deduction (up to ₹1.5L), interest is tax-free, and maturity amount is completely tax-free.
Power of 15+ Years
With a 15-year minimum lock-in extended in 5-year blocks, PPF leverages long-term compounding. ₹1.5L/year at 7.1% grows to ₹40.7L in 15 years — you invest only ₹22.5L!
